Grains Corn closed @ $7.43 just up from last week’s close of $7.35. Initial harvest reports are a bit troubling and weather has not been helping. There is concern yields could be substantially reduced which could be pushing prices higher once the harvest is in hand. Something I will be watching. Soy oil is holding pretty steady, there was a small increase earlier this week but nothing to alarming. The soy harvest could be similarly affected by weather as corn. Winter wheat harvest is done, summer wheat harvest is in process and running behind. International issues may push prices higher but right now, it looks pretty steady.
